That hydrometer is for Methanol Nige.

For biodiesel you need a hydrometer with a 0.85 - 0.9 range.

Surely the viscosity of your bio is more important.

basically the diesel range SG

also these need to be used in a controlled environment at the set temp for the hydrometer say 15/16c else will be inaccurate.

when I was doing miss fuel (petrol/diesel) mixes I couldn't get 1 hydrometer with both scales on meaning the scale range wouldn't fit into a hydrometer, so had to adapt the diesel one setting my own marks for controlled amounts in test samples, I did contact a company who would of made a one off hydrometer for me but to a very expensive cost.
